Just purchased a 2003 350z, looking to buy a Invidia N1 Exhaust, and i have some concerns about state inspections regarding the loudness of the exhaust. Can anyone share any insight in this situation? Car right now is bone stock. |
Nothing has changed it’s not a new law. the only thing that changed is that it’s no longer s fix it ticket with court. its just straight to fines now. $25 - $1,000 per offense. Judge decides how much each offense. If you don’t want to pay tickets don’t get it. If you want to chance it and can afford tickets go for it. but it’s not a new law, it’s just new penalties. |

I've got a motordyne/stock cats in PA and nobody has ever questioned it during the inspection. Did it at the Nissan dealer where I bought it, too, so they know I changed it out. They tried to gouge me on brake pads too, so if they thought they could fail me on it, I suspect they would have tried. Wouldn't worry too much unless you're planning to go test pipes and no mufflers/obnoxiously loud exhaust
